The jobs this tool completes

Built around the failure points.

01

Physical and logical key evidence

Compare `code` for physical position with `key` for the interpreted character.

02

Stuck and repeat visibility

Show keydown, keyup, repeat, and currently held state so a missing release is obvious.

03

Combination and rollover test

Display simultaneous held keys and the maximum observed combination without claiming hardware certification.
